RT2300(R)/RT2400(R) rev 2 9/2/99 3:30 PM Page ii Make sure you connect all your other electronic components and the speakers before plugging your receiver into the outlet. Connecting for power Plug the power cord in the wall outlet, matching the wide blade of the plug with the wide slot in the outlet.

RT2300(R)/RT2400(R) rev 2 9/2/99 3:30 PM Page 23 What your warranty covers: • Any defect in materials or workmanship. For how long after your purchase: • One year. (The warranty period for rental units begins with the first rental or 45 days from date of shipment to the rental firm, whichever comes first.) What we will do: •...
